Output 63fe743307a3e721159fd971fe28de6af508ea40d23cf33a53fdec769668febd:7

value
23379
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a0738ae5fa9809d0175815df297be92bd94c700f3e245a3bd747d1b565263d79
address
bc1p5pec4e06nqyaq96czh0jj7lf90v5cuq08cj95w7hglgm2efx84usrczxq9
transaction
63fe743307a3e721159fd971fe28de6af508ea40d23cf33a53fdec769668febd
spent
true